[Bug 16492] [NEW] Mouse pointer should disappear when keyboard is in use and mouse isn't

 

Chris Wilson (notgary) has assigned this bug to you for gtk+2.0 in Ubuntu Maverick:

Steps to reproduce:
1.  Click near the top left of a text field to focus it.
2.  Start typing.
Or:
1.  Click in a browser window to focus the page.
2.  Read the page, scrolling with the arrow keys.
Or:
1.  Click in an e-mail message window to focus the message.
2.  Read the message, scrolling with the arrow keys.

What happens:
*   The mouse pointer gets in the way of what you're typing/reading.

What should happen:
*   Whenever you press a non-modifier key on the keyboard, if the pointing
device has been neither moved nor clicked in the past ~0.25 seconds, the pointer
should disappear until the pointing device is next moved or clicked.

But won't this make people lose the pointer?
*   No. For human eyes, such a small object is much easier to find by movement
than by searching the entire screen. As soon as they grab the mouse again, the
pointer will appear, and they'll see where it is.

This is nuts!
*   It's worked on the Mac for over two decades. Most people haven't noticed.
They just get slightly irritated on *other* platforms when the pointer gets in
the way.
